Job description: As a Mechanical Engineer working in the waste water industry sector, you would be expected to carry out a wide range of planned and reactive maintenance on water industry assets. You will be working as part of a highly skilled and experienced mobile team in and around the Redruth areas, and you will be provided with a van and tools to ensure you are able to provide a valuable service to the water industry.

As a Mechanical Engineer in the water industry, you would be expected to: Carry out planned and reactive maintenance on water industry equipment. Respond to breakdowns as per business requirements and use your experience to repair/replace the defective equipment. This would include equipment such as but not limited to Motors, Gearboxes, Screens, Pumps, Chemical Dosing Systems, Valves, and Hydraulic/Pneumatic systems. Work closely with operations to ensure that equipment is running efficiently. Identify any potential issues with equipment and proactively plan in maintenance before asset failure occurs. Attend jobs as directed by your line manager to fault find, investigate, and repair/replace. Manufacture parts and equipment to reduce the downtime of assets. Ensure that all work by yourself and the team that you are working with is carried out safely and to industry best practice.

What we are looking for: Essentials: Time served apprenticeship supported by relevant formal qualifications, e.g., City and Guilds, Diploma, BTEC, ONC/HNC/HND. Full UK Driving License. Desirables: Water Industry knowledge. C&G Confined Space Medium Risk. Manual Handling. Working at Heights. Fire Safety. Chemical Handling/COSH. Knowledge of working with Risk Assessments and Method Statements (RAMS). Have the ability to fault-find utilising a structured and analytical approach through to the repair of complex and specialist items of mechanical equipment.
